[Jack Jansen] > I can't build from the CVS tree right now (confirmed on Irix and OSX): > setup.py crashes. Here's the stacktrace: > > CC='cc' LDSHARED='ld -shared -all' ./python -E ./setup.py build > Traceback (most recent call last): > File "./setup.py", line 708, in ? > main() > File "./setup.py", line 702, in main > scripts = ['Tools/scripts/pydoc'] > File "/ufs/jack/src/python/Lib/distutils/core.py", line 101, in setup > _setup_distribution = dist = klass(attrs) > File"/ufs/jack/src/python/Lib/distutils/dist.py", line 129, in __init__ > setattr(self, method_name, getattr(self.metadata, method_name)) > AttributeError: DistributionMetadata instance has no attribute > 'get___doc__' Unless I miss my bet, Neil fixed this now, and it was due to that dir(instance) now returns the attributes of instance.__class__ in addition to the keys in instance.__dict__. Most relevant here, that means dir(instance) now contains '__doc__' (really an attribute of its class) but didn't before (and dist starting synthesizing a non-existent "get"+"__doc__" method name as a consequence).
